Why we rated Colonia de Vacaciones Dracula 8LP

Colonia de Vacaciones Dracula is written at a Level 3-4 reading level across 126 pages (approximately 23,881 words). Strong independent readers around grade 4.6 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Colonia de Vacaciones Dracula works for readers up to grade 5.6.

Read aloud, Colonia de Vacaciones Dracula runs about 2.7 hours — long enough to span several bedtime sessions.

We rate Colonia de Vacaciones Dracula as 8LP ("Light — Physical") because the content sits in the "Mild" range — mild conflict — the kind a child encounters in normal play and sibling life.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ly mild; no single dimension stands out as a concern.

Specific content flags noted by reviewers: Mild Peril, Fantasy Violence.

Thematically, Colonia de Vacaciones Dracula explores mystery, humor, adventure, and fantasy world-building —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
